The Shore Organisation of Regional Councils (SHOROC) represents Mosman, Manly, Warringah and Pittwater Councils which are located within Sydney's Inner North and North East Regions. The study was commissioned in response to the release of two draft subregional strategies by the (DoP) that are relevant to the SHOROC Region, namely the draft Inner North Subregional Strategy and the draft North East Subregional Strategy. These strategies establish targets and actions for the sustainable growth of the aforementioned subregions over the next 24 years (i.e. up to 2031). The study was commissioned to assist in the refinement of the Subregional Strategies and in the preparation of a Regional Economic Development Strategy.
